Dear Mr. Collins:
The Federal Highway Administration (FHWA)
has approved the de-designation request submitted by Jersey County
on July 3, 2002 and transmitted to the FHWA by the department
on September 20, 2002. De-designation has been approved for Illinois
100 from the Greene County line south to the northern boundary
of Pere Marquette State Park, including that part of Illinois
100 adjacent to the Legate property on the south side of Pere
Marquette State Park.
Enclosed is a copy of the September 27,
2002 letter from the FHWA informing the department of the approved
portions of the Jersey County de-designation.
